Specifications:

Engine, Lycoming O-290-D 125hp

Fuel, 80 minimum octane aviation gasoline

Engine Limits For all operations, 2600 rpm (125 hp)

Airspeed Limits Maneuvering 106 mph (92 knots) True Ind.

Maximum Structural Cruising 126 mph (110 knots) True Ind.

Never Exceed 158 mph (137 knots) True Ind.

Flaps Extended 80 mph (70 knots) True Ind.

Maximum Weight 1800 lbs.

Number of Seats 4

Maximum Baggage 50 lbs

Fuel Capacity 36 gallons

Oil Capacity 2 gallons

 

A few facts about the Piper Pacer:

First into production in 1949

Production ended in 1954

Total built was 1120

There is currently only 561 left registered with the FAA

107 of which are registered in Alaska.
